Submit a formal Letter of Withdrawal addressed to the Director of the Office of Admissions and Student Services (OASS). Receipt of the letter is to be acknowledged by OASS via email to the student's WSU email address. The official Letter of Withdrawal shall include: The date of withdrawal and the reason for withdrawal.

You are academically withdrawn from a program at the end of a term if you are in academic probation for two consecutive terms. This means that your grades are not high enough for you to graduate. If you have been academically withdrawn from a program, you may choose to apply to another program right away.

Wayne Med-Direct program is a binding Early Decision program. Students may apply to other regular admissions or non-binding early decision programs. If you apply to the Wayne Med-Direct program, you may not apply for binding Early Decision to any other school.
